The Prodigals are Running


The prodigals are running
To open air and sky
Strangled by religion
Oppressed by judging eyes

Hypocrisy is rampant
What we say is not our truth
But we judge the world around us
And everything they do

In fear, the church has faltered
Afraid of differences
Instead of staying open
We come with closed up fists

It’s time to check our motive
Of what we think and say
Is it lining up with Jesus
With His message and His way?


Using only best words
Over us He sings
The Father speaks out purpose
And transforms everything

Souls find affirmation
And blinded eyes gain sight
God confirms identities
Only found in Christ

It’s time for second chances
The church can make it right
Use the words the Father sings
To bring back home His bride

The prodigals are running
Back to home sweet home
Where Father breathes His freedom
And life on these dry bones
